Modèle d'évaluation des exigences techniques - AWS Directives prescriptives

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Modèle d'évaluation des exigences techniques

Fournissez des informations sur les types d'ingestion de données :

Type d'ingestion de données

OU/N

Description

Frequency (Fréquence)

Accès aux applications

Y

 

 

Passerelle API

Y

 

 

Streaming de données

N

 

 

Procédé Batch

N

 

 

ETL

N

 

 

Importation de données

N

 

 

Séries chronologiques

N

 

 

Fournissez des informations sur les types de consommation de données :

Type de consommation de données

OU/N

Description

Frequency (Fréquence)

Accès aux applications

 

 

 

Passerelle API

 

 

 

Exportation de données

 

 

 

Analyses de données

 

 

 

Agrégation de données

 

 

 

Génération de rapports

 

 

 

Rechercher

 

 

 

Streaming de données

 

 

 

ETL

 

 

 

Fournissez des estimations du volume de données :

Nom de l'entité

Nombre estimé d'enregistrements

Taille de l'enregistrement

Volume de données

Joueur de jeu

1 MM

< 1 Ko

~ 1 Go

(1 MM* 1 KO)

Instance de jeu

6 MM

(100K/jour * 60 jours)

< 1 Ko

~ 6 Go

(6 MM* 1 KO)

Cartographie des utilisateurs du jeu

300 MM

(6 jeux MM* 50 joueurs)

< 1 Ko

~ 300 Go

(300 MM* 1 KO)

Note

La durée de conservation des données est de 60 jours. Après 60 jours, les données doivent être stockées dans Amazon S3 à des fins d'analyse, en utilisant DynamoDB Time to Live (TTL) pour déplacer automatiquement les données de DynamoDB vers Amazon S3.

Répondez aux questions suivantes concernant les modèles temporels :

  • Dans quels délais l'application est-elle accessible à l'utilisateur (par exemple, 24 heures sur 24, 7 jours sur 7 ou de 9 h à 17 h en semaine) ?

  • Y a-t-il un pic d'utilisation pendant la journée ? Combien d'heures ? Quel est le pourcentage d'utilisation des applications ?

Spécifiez les exigences en matière de débit d'écriture :

Nom de l'entité

Écrivres/jour

Heures/jour

écritures/seconde

Joueur de jeu

10 000 mises à jour

18

< 1

Instance de jeu

300 000

18

< 5

Cartographie des utilisateurs du jeu

1 800 000 000

18

~ 27,777

Remarques

Opérations d'écriture sur Game Player : 1 % des utilisateurs mettent à jour leur profil chaque jour. Nous prévoyons donc 10 000 mises à jour pour 1 000 000 d'utilisateurs.

Opérations d'écriture des instances de jeu : 100 000 jeux/jour. Pour chaque jeu, nous avons au moins 3 opérations d'écriture (à la création, au début et à la fin), soit un total de 300 000 opérations d'écriture.

Opérations d'écriture du mappage des utilisateurs du jeu : 100 000 jeux/jour pour chaque jeu à 50 joueurs. La durée moyenne d'une partie est de 30 minutes et la position du joueur est mise à jour toutes les 5 secondes. Nous estimons une moyenne de 360 mises à jour par joueur, donc le total est de 100 000 * 50 * 360 = 1 800 000 000 d'opérations d'écriture.

Spécifiez les exigences en matière de débit de lecture :

Nom de l'entité

Lectures par jour

Heures/jour

Lectures par seconde

Joueur de jeu

200 000

18

~ 3

Instance de jeu

5 000 000

18

~ 77

Cartographie des utilisateurs du jeu

1 800 000 000

18

~ 27,777

Remarques

Opérations de lecture du Game Player : 20 % des utilisateurs démarrent une partie, donc 1 MM* 0,2 = 200 000.

Opérations de lecture des instances de jeu : 100 000 jeux/jour. Pour chaque jeu, nous avons au moins 1 opération de lecture par joueur et 50 joueurs par partie, soit un total de 5 000 000 d'opérations de lecture.

Opérations de lecture du Game User Mapping : 100 000 parties par jour pour 50 joueurs. La durée moyenne d'une partie est de 30 minutes et la position du joueur est mise à jour toutes les 5 secondes. Nous estimons une moyenne de 360 mises à jour par joueur, et chaque mise à jour nécessite une opération de lecture. Le total est donc de 100 000 * 50 * 360 = 1 800 000 000 d'opérations de lecture.

Spécifiez les exigences de latence d'accès aux données :

Opération

99 percentiles

Latence maximale

Lecture

30 millisecondes

100 millisecondes

Write (Écrire)

10 millisecondes

50 millisecondes

Spécifiez les exigences en matière de disponibilité des données :

Exigence

OU/N

Métrique

Remarques

Haute disponibilité

Y

99,9 %

 

RTO

Y

1 heure

Objectif en matière de temps de rétablissement

RPO

Y

1 heure

Objectif du point de rétablissement

Reprise après sinistre

N

 

 

Réplication des données dans la région

N

 

 

Réplication des données entre régions

N

Latence de 3 secondes

Lequel Régions AWS ?

Spécifiez les exigences de sécurité :

Exigence

OU/N

Remarques

Stockage de données sensibles

N

Informations de santé protégées (PHI), informations du secteur des cartes de paiement (PCI), informations personnelles identifiables (PII) ?

Chiffrement au repos

Y

 

Chiffrement en transit

Y

 

Chiffrement côté client

N

 

Toute bibliothèque de chiffrement propriétaire ou tierce

N

 

Enregistrement des accès aux données

N

 

Audit de l'accès aux données

N